[sf] update latch time only for layers that will not be latched

Latching happens after the transactions are committed, so fix an
issue where we passed in the incorrect latch time for buffer layers
that was used to classify jank.

Note: this will probably cause a perf regression but this is fixing
an incorrect jank classification caused by
Ie211aa3bd5821f6052cf84a62a2e245132a19d90

Bug: 270041584
Test: presubmit
